Bahr, Behrend & Co., Ltd., traces its origins back to Lorentz Hansen, whose name first appears in Gore's Liverpool Directory for 1790 as a book-keeper. As a ship broker Hansen was successful. Charles Louis Bahr became his partner in 1814 and in 1835 as sole partner, Bahr was joined by two other Liverpool shipbrokers, David Behrend and Henry Alexander Stewart. The firm was hence forward known as Bahr, Behrend & Stewart until Stewart left in 1847. Bahr, Behrend & Co. remained in private partnership until 1 June 1958 when it became a private limited company. As shipbrokers Bahr, Behrend & Co., Ltd., also have a controlling interest in Bahr, Behrend & Co. (Chartering) Ltd., Bahr, Behrend, Roberts & Co., Ltd., and Bahr Trustees Ltd.
